Un gros morceau en moins sur ma liste de livres à lire, mais aussi une grosse déception. Les personnages principaux m’ont tous semblé plus inintéressants les uns que les autres et l’intrigue m’a laissé complètement indifférent.

C’est long aussi, interminable même. Je sais que c’est un peu l’idée derrière, puisque c’est une critique du système de justice et des dossiers qui s’éternisent pendant des années jusqu’à l’absurdité, mais ça ne rend pas l’expérience agréable pour autant.

Dickens aurait sans doute pu couper dans le gras sans rien sacrifier de son message et sans perdre son effet. Un roman de 1400 pages, c’est déjà du sport, mais quand tous les personnages sont insupportables, c’est un supplice. Le roman est super bien construit et sa forme a même quelque chose de moderne, mais en définitive quand ni l’histoire, ni la psychologie des personnages, ni les dialogues ne captivent, il ne reste pas grand-chose. I feel like the book is so long, the first half and second half deserve different star ratings. The first half was a real slog. I struggled to keep up with the characters and any sort of overarching plot. But it definitely picked up in the back half, and I think my overall reading experience was positive. I wasn't a huge fan as Esther as a narrator. She was a little too goody goody for me. But I definitely enjoyed the murder mystery element with Mr. Bucket and Lady Dedlock, and I thought Dickens wrapped up things up well...except for that ending...
